The best red wines to cook with are medium-bodied but not overly tannic, like Merlot or Grenache. Tannins in wine become more concentrated as you cook them, so a tannic wine may dry out the dish or cause astringent flavours. ‘If cooking with reds, I avoid Pinot Noir. It is too elegant for the heat of a pan.
